How they compare

United States of America currently reports 23,013 million t against 5,306 million t in Guyana, a difference of 17,707 million t.

That makes United States of America's figure about 4.3 times Guyana's.

Across all 36 years both countries report, United States of America has been ahead every year.

Guyana ranks 13th and United States of America ranks 12th of 215 countries.

United States of America has averaged higher in every one of the 4 decades both report.

Head to head by decade

Decade Guyana United States of America Difference Ahead
1990s 5,366 million t 16,968 million t 11,602 million t United States of America
2000s 5,354 million t 19,194 million t 13,840 million t United States of America
2010s 5,333 million t 21,428 million t 16,095 million t United States of America
2020s 5,312 million t 22,748 million t 17,436 million t United States of America

Averages of every year both report within each decade.

The FAOSTAT Land Use domain contains data on twenty-one land use categories and twenty-three categories of irrigation and agricultural practices. Data are available yearly and by country, regional and global levels. The domain includes Land Use Indicators providing information on the percentage share of agricultural and forest land, and their sub-components, including irrigated areas and areas under organic agriculture, within a country land use matrix. Data are available at country, regional and global level, for the following elements: (in percentage) i) Share in Land area; ii) Share in Agricultural land, iii) Share in Cropland; and iv) Share in Forest land; (in ha/pc) v) Area per capita.
